Make the Most of Your Under-Sink Storage: Bathroom Edition
The bathroom is often considered a haven for clutter. With toiletries, cleaning supplies, towels, and more vying for space, it's easy for things to pile up and create a chaotic environment. But don't despair! The under-sink area, often neglected and underutilized, holds the key to unlocking a more organized and efficient bathroom. With thoughtful planning and some smart storage solutions, you can transform this space into a haven of calm and order.
1. Assess Your Needs and Declutter
Before embarking on any organizational project, it's crucial to understand what you have and what you truly need. Take an inventory of all items stored under your sink, categorizing them into essential, frequently used, and rarely used items. Be honest with yourself. Are there expired products you can discard? Can you consolidate duplicates? This decluttering process will provide a clear picture of what needs to be stored and how much space you actually need.
2. Maximize Vertical Space with Shelves and Drawers
The key to efficient under-sink storage is maximizing vertical space. Consider installing shelves or drawers to create tiered storage solutions. This approach allows you to stack items vertically, making the most of the often underutilized vertical space. Opt for adjustable systems that can be tailored to fit different sized items, ensuring optimal utilization of every inch. You can choose from materials like wire, plastic, or wood, depending on your aesthetic preferences and budget.
For smaller items like cotton balls, makeup brushes, or hair ties, dedicated drawer organizers can help create dedicated compartments and prevent them from becoming a jumbled mess. These organizers come in a variety of sizes and configurations, catering to individual needs and preferences.
3. Embrace the Power of Bins and Baskets
Bins and baskets are organizational superheroes, providing a structured and visually appealing way to group similar items. Opt for clear bins to quickly identify the contents, while baskets offer a more stylish and concealed approach. Label each bin or basket clearly to facilitate easy retrieval and ensure everyone in the household knows where everything belongs. Dedicated bins for hair styling tools, first aid supplies, or cleaning products can create a sense of order and improve accessibility.
4. Utilize Doors and Walls for Additional Storage
Don't limit yourself to just the under-sink area. The back of the door and the walls surrounding the vanity offer valuable storage opportunities. Over-the-door organizers are readily available and cater to various needs, from storing towels and toiletries to holding cleaning supplies and medications.
Wall-mounted shelves or baskets can also add vertical storage solutions without taking up valuable floor space. Consider using magnetic strips for storing metal items like tweezers, nail clippers, or scissors, freeing up valuable drawer space.
5. Consider a Rolling Cart
For larger bathrooms with ample space, a rolling cart can be a game-changer. This versatile storage solution offers mobility, allowing you to move your supplies as needed. Choose a cart with multiple tiers and compartments to accommodate various items and keep them organized.
6. Maintain Order and Consistency
Once you've implemented your chosen storage solutions, the key to maintaining a clutter-free bathroom is consistency. Make it a habit to put things away immediately after use. Regularly declutter and donate items you no longer need. Create a system for keeping your under-sink storage clean and organized. This ongoing effort will ensure your bathroom remains a haven of peace and order for the long term.
